• Chile votes to reject new constitution | International | EL PAÍS ...

    2 days ago · ELVIS GONZÁLEZ (EFE) Chile voted overwhelmingly against a new, progressive constitution on Sunday. A total of 62% of voters voted "no" to the measure, while 38% supported it. Even the most pessimistic polls did not anticipate such a wide margin. The result is a huge blow for the government of Gabriel Boric, who had staked everything on the ...

  • Mapping the Impact of Salmon Farming in Southern Chile

     · Chile's oncefledgling salmon aquaculture industry is now the second largest in the world, writes Alexei Koseff for the Woods Institute for the Environment. Since 1990, the industry has grown 24fold and now annually exports more than halfamillion tons of fish worth billions of dollars, according to the Chilean government.

  • Rural Systems Mitigate Impact of Overuse of Water in Chile

     · RENGO, Chile, Aug 16 2022 (IPS) Local leaders of the Rural Sanitation Services (RSS) warn that the digging of illegal wells by large agroexport companies in Chile is aggravating the effects of drought and threatening drinking water supplies and social peace.

  • [Assessing the economic impact of cancer in Chile: a direct and ...

     · Indirect costs were calculated by days of job absenteeism and potential years of life lost. Results: Over US billion were spent on cancer in 2009, which represents almost 1% of Chile s Gross Domestic Product. The direct per capita cost was US 47. Indirect costs were times more than direct costs.

  • Regulatory impact assessment in Chile

    Regulatory impact assessment in Chile Following the 2016 OECD Regulatory Policy Review, which stems from the Chilean National Agenda for Productivity, Innovation and Growth, the government of Chile issued a Presidential Instructive to introduce regulatory impact assessments in the rulemaking process called productivity reports in Chile.

  • COVID19 crisis could reverse years of growth in Chile's middleclass

     · Recent surveys have found that the employment impacts have been particularly severe among women, informal and lowskilled workers. Others continued to work but at the risk of contracting COVID19. A recent study showed that mobility was reduced by 6080 % in high income areas of Santiago, while it was reduced by only 2040 % in low income areas.

  • Chile rejects proposed constitution, granting salmon sector a .

    21 hours ago · Chile's current constitution was enacted in 1980 under the Augusto Pinochet dictatorship, and a new constitution was proposed in October 2019 as a way to plae the social unrest and violence that has rocked Chile for years, affecting key parts of the economy, including salmon production and exports.
